As of February 1, 2025, Google Play will no longer offer Play Gift Cards and Gift Card-funded Play Balance to users in Singapore. Any Play Gift Cards and Gift Card-funded Play Balance you have remaining will expire on January 31, 2025 and will no longer be usable after that date. If you have unredeemed Gift Cards, you will need to first redeem them to your Play Balance and spend such Play Balance by that date to avoid losing the value of your Gift Card.

What is considered Gift Card-funded Play Balance?

Gift Card-funded Play Balance refers to Play Balance that you have redeemed from Play Gift Cards. This is separate from any promotional Play Balance you may have received (e.g. from Google-run promotions).

I don’t have enough Play Balance to purchase an item. How do I spend the remaining Play Balance?

To cover a purchase, you can combine Play Balance with other payment methods such as a credit/debit card, or PayPal. If you only have Play Balance, you can add a credit card or other forms of payment method to your Google account by following the instructions here.

Can I purchase additional Play Gift Cards?

No, Google Play Gift Cards are no longer available in Singapore as of December 1, 2020.
